Group Executive Committee
The Executive Committee has responsibility for the day-to-day running of the business and the execution of the Group’s strategy.
|

|
Brett Dawson Chief Executive Officer Brett Dawson was appointed Group CEO in March 2004. He joined Dimension Data in 1997 and has held numerous positions within the Group. He first acted as Financial Director of the Group joint venture, OmniLink. Following the merger of OmniLink and Internet Solutions, Brett was appointed CEO of Internet Solutions. In September 2001, he relocated to take on the role of Chief Financial Officer of Dimension Data North America. In October 2002, he was appointed to the role of Chief Operating Officer. In February 2011, Brett was appointed to the board of Keane International Inc. Prior to joining Dimension Data, Brett was responsible for corporate strategy and planning at National Brands Limited and held corporate finance positions at Anglovaal Limited and KPMG. Brett is a Chartered Accountant.

David Sherriffs Chief Financial Officer David Sherriffs was appointed Chief Financial Officer in March 2004. He joined the Group in 1997 as a member of the finance team, primarily involved in corporate finance activities. In 2000, David was named Vice President of Business Development for Europe and relocated to Germany. From 2003, David served as Group Executive: Operations and was responsible for business case assessments for strategic projects. Prior to joining Dimension Data, David served in various financial, corporate finance and strategy roles for Anglo American plc, including Executive Assistant to the Chairman. David received his M. Phil in Management Studies from the University of Oxford. David is a Chartered Accountant.

Jason Goodall Chief Operating Officer Jason Goodall was appointed Chief Operating Officer for Dimension Data’s Systems Integration business globally in October 2010. Prior to this, Jason was Managing Director of Dimension Data Middle East & Africa responsible for Emerging Africa and the Middle East. In 2003 Jason joined Dimension Data South Africa’s executive team, heading up the Converged Infrastructure business. In 1998 Jason was appointed Chief Financial Officer, OmniLink - a Dimension Data subsidiary which later merged with Internet Solutions. From 2001 to 2003 Jason held the position of Chief Operating Officer at Internet Solutions, where he was instrumental in building the company into a highly profitable and successful company. Jason also sits on the board of Britehouse Technologies. Jason qualified as a chartered accountant, and completed his articles at Deloitte & Touche in 1992. Thereafter, as a bursary recipient from Barlow Rand, he joined ISM/IBM in the role of Financial Manager for the Solutions Group Resolve Technologies. While at IBM, Jason held a number of roles in both finance and sales before being appointed Financial Controller – Industries and Product in 1996.

Tetsuro Yamaguchi Group Executive: Joint Business Development
Mr. Tetsuro Yamaguchi was appointed a Board member and group executive of Dimension Data in February 2011. His primary responsibility is to promote business collaboration between Dimension Data and the various NTT companies across the world, as one NTT Group. From July 2006, Mr. Yamaguchi served as President and CEO of NTT America. In this role, he oversaw NTT America’s strategic initiatives including product development, carrier and vendor relations, and NTT’s company-wide revenue growth efforts. Mr. Yamaguchi joined NTT Public Corporation in 1979. He has served in a number of managerial and strategic planning roles across the organisation, including vice president of the Financial Industry Sales Department, Enterprise Sales Division from 2005 to 2006, general manager in the Corporate Planning Department from 2000 to 2001, deputy managing director of NTT Deutschland (Germany) from 1993 to 1995, and general manager in the Planning Development Department for NTT Media Scope, a joint venture between NTT and several Japanese media companies from 1987 to 1992. Mr Yamaguchi has a Master of Business Administration degree from MIT’s Sloan School of Management (1993),and a BA in Economics from Waseda University (1979).

Derek Wilcocks
Chief Executive Officer, Dimension Data Middle East & Africa
Derek was appointed CEO of Dimension Data Middle East & Africa in April 2012 after serving as Managing Director of Internet Solutions from October 2009. He joined the Dimension Data Group in 1995 as founding Managing Director of Trusted Network Solutions, and joined Internet Solutions a year later (1996), becoming a board member. Derek has held numerous executive positions during his 16 years with the Group. In 2001, he was appointed Executive: Strategy & Technology for Dimension Data Middle East & Africa. In 2006, he assumed the position of Services Executive for the region. Derek has delivered numerous talks on the difference ICT can make to developing countries in South Africa, Nigeria, Namibia, Burkina Faso and Kenya. Derek graduated from the University of the Witwatersrand with a B.Econ.Sc; B.Sc (Hons) (Computer Science). He also completed the Executive Programme in Strategy and Organisation at Stanford University, as well as a Postgraduate Professional Course in Corporate Finance at the University of London.
